HPMT 33103
INTRODUCTION TO DISEASE
Arkansas State University · UGRD · Fall 2026
3 sections3 open now
Catalog description
Basic principles of disease processes, covering essential structural and functional characteristics of common diseases. Attention will be given to individual body systems and the diseases, disturbances, and abnormalities affecting them. Requires admission to the BSHS program or Departmental Approval. Prerequisite, Grade of C or better in HP 2112. Fall.
